Autumn Classic, Kulkyne Way, Saturday 30 May 2009
Autumn Classic 2009
Mildura-Coomealla Cycling Club staged its 2009 Autumn Classic on a modified Kulkyne Way course on Saturday 30 May 2009. The event, which was kindly sponsored by Coomealla Memorial Sporting Club, saw 21 seniors race under handicap conditions over 108 km, whilst ten juniors raced over 30 km. The Club welcomed its newest member, junior Tom Allford (JM13).
The seniors course comprised of the regular Kulkyne Way course but included two “detours”. The first added about 5 km to the race and saw riders turn-off to the Lindemans Winery and execute a turnaround in front of the Lindemans security gate. The second, which added about 28 km to the usual course, saw riders directed up Brownport Road to Carwarp before returning to Kulkyne Way. Conditions were fine for the race but riders had to contest a moderate ESE wind, which made for a headwind on the outward leg.
A controversial sprint finish saw Gary Henderson take the win from Dean Taylor and Nathan Langley, with Henderson also taking the award for fastest time in 2:38:07 hours. In the juniors race young Tom Allford took the win in his first outing, with second place going to Nathan Jordan (JM15). Ben Athorn (JM17) took third place and fastest time in 54:11 minutes.
